Jamieson, Fausset, and Brown
And when the daughter of the said Herodias—that is,—her daughter by her proper husband, Herod Philip: Her name was Salome [JOSEPHUS, Antiquities, 18.5,4].
came in and danced, and pleased Herod and them that sat with him, the king said unto the damsel—"the girl" (See on Mark 5:42).
Ask of me whatsoever thou wilt, and I will give it thee.
